The ANBG was set up by the Natural Death Centre within the early days of the charity with the intention of helping fledging operators to deal with the authorities in establishing them, and to clarify the philosophy and the practicalities of these new forms of burial ground. It is dedicated to the development of the quantity and quality of natural burial ground provision across the UK. It's members are bound by a code of conduct aimed at raising both professional and environmental standards. All member sites are required to issue a standard feedback form and these are returned to the ANBG headquarters which enables us to accurately monitor the quality of service and support provided. It also allows the families using these sites to present any complaints or issues, as well as praise or thanks they may have through the formal and professional framework of the ANBG. If a site is a non member, then we do not have the same consistent level of feedback, and so we are not in such a good position to comment on their standards. Whether you are considering a member or non member site for your burial, or the burial of someone you love, we would strongly advise you to make contact with the burial operator, and to visit the site before making a decision.
